Delhi Man Killed After Fight: Three Arrested, Body Dumped in Faridabad Forest

A Delhi man killed after fight during a drinking session has led to three arrests in the national capital. Delhi Police arrested the accused after Vikas Mavi, 27, died following a violent altercation in Tughlakabad on December 6. Subsequently, the perpetrators dumped his body in a forested area near Surajkund in Faridabad.

Timeline of Events

The incident unfolded over several days. First, Vikas attended a wedding on the evening of December 6. Later, he visited an office belonging to Keshav Bidhuri in Tughlakabad village, where several men were drinking. Moreover, an argument over an old dispute quickly escalated into violence.

What Happened During the Fight?

According to police investigations, the argument turned deadly when someone smashed a bottle on Vikas’s head. Furthermore, the attackers stomped on his neck, causing fatal injuries. When they realized he had died, panic set in.

Instead of calling for help, the group placed his body in a car. Additionally, they drove around for some time before deciding to dispose of the body. Eventually, they dumped it in the forest near Surajkund in neighboring Faridabad.

Investigation and Arrests

Vikas’s family filed a missing person report at Govindpuri police station on December 8. Consequently, police formed a special team to trace his movements. They analyzed mobile phone records and CCTV footage, which provided crucial leads.

Investigators discovered that Vikas was last seen with Vishal Rai on the night of December 6-7. Therefore, police detained Rai for questioning. During interrogation, he confessed to the crime and revealed details about what happened that night.

Arrested Suspects:

  • Vishal Rai (28) – First to be apprehended
  • Praveen alias Pummy (48) – Has multiple criminal cases
  • Keshav Bidhuri (40) – No previous criminal record

Evidence Tampering

The accused attempted to cover their tracks by destroying evidence. Specifically, Rahul Bidhuri, the fourth suspect still absconding, allegedly broke a CCTV camera that captured the fight. Moreover, they removed the CCTV Digital Video Recorder (DVR) from the locality.

However, police successfully traced and recovered the DVR. Additionally, they recovered Vikas’s car and body from the locations identified by the accused during questioning.

Ongoing Investigation

Police continue searching for Rahul Bidhuri, who remains at large. According to reports, both Rahul and Keshav are related to a former member of Parliament. Furthermore, preliminary verification shows that Rai and Praveen have multiple past involvements in criminal cases.

Authorities are making continuous efforts to locate and arrest the absconding suspect. Meanwhile, the three arrested men face charges of murder and tampering with evidence.
